City of Richmond
Thanks to a partnership with industry, Richmond is expanding
recycling collection services for all residents.
The new program changes how residents sort their recycling plus expands the types of materials
residents can recycle. Starting the week of May 19th, more types of plastic containers, milk cartons,
paper and plastic drink cups, flower pots and spiral-bound tins like frozen concentrate containers
can be recycled. This expanded program will help residents divert more materials from the garbage
and contribute toward 70% waste diversion by 2015.
Blue Cart Expanded Program:
NEW: Combine all your newsprint, flattened cardboard and paper product items into the
newly labelled Mixed Paper Recycling Cart.
NEW: Place any glass bottles and jars into the new Glass Recycling Cart.
EXPANDED: Use the Containers Recycling Cart for all recyclable containers including many
new items added through this expanded program.

DID YOU KNOW?Styrofoam and plastic bags can be taken to the Richmond Recycling Depot (5555 Lynas Lane) for recycling.
WHAT’S NEW?Starting the week of May 19th, Richmond is expanding its Blue Box and Blue Cart recycling programs. This expanded program will help residents divert more materials from the garbage and contribute toward 70% waste diversion by 2015.
Residents will be able to recycle many new items such as aerosol containers, paper and plastic drink cups, milk cartons, gable top containers used for soy milk and juice, plastic and paper garden pots and bakery trays, along with many more items. By recycling more, residents are helping to divert waste from disposal which in turn saves on landfill disposal costs.
Thanks to partnership with industry (Multi-Material BC), the responsibility for residential recycling programs are shifting to producers making companies responsible for the waste they produce.

BLUE BOX RECYCLING SERVICE
Thanks to a partnership with industry, Richmond is expanding
recycling collection services for all residents.
The new program changes how residents sort their recycling plus expands the types of materials
residents can recycle. Starting the week of May 19th, more types of plastic containers, milk cartons,
paper and plastic drink cups, flower pots and spiral-bound tins like frozen concentrate containers
can be recycled. This expanded program will help residents divert more materials from the garbage
and contribute toward 70% waste diversion by 2015.
Your new program includes:
A NEW larger yellow recycling bag labelled “Mixed Paper”. Combine all your newsprint,
flattened cardboard and paper product items and place into this re-usable bag.
A NEW grey recycling bin for glass labelled “Glass Jars & Bottles”. Place any glass bottles
and jars into this container.
Your existing Blue Box is used for all recyclable containers including many new items
added through this expanded program.
